Great value per dollar
Pros: You really cannot beat this for the money. It has PSU and IR reciever and display - just buy it. It also has a cool, retro VCR look. blends in nicely. Plenty of room for wires, stays cool and quiet.
Cons: Poor directions. Would have been nice to have trouble shooting section and wiring diagram or something. Had to use google to figure the tricky stuff out. The power runs through the front display, which concerns me. If you wire this like a nomal case, it will not turn on. Also, concerned if front display breaks, is case done for? Ill take the risk for $100
Overall Review: People are upsetting me dinging this case becuase of its size. Half the people say it is too long: IT HAS THE DIMENSIONS IN THE PRODUCT DESCRIPTION. Other half say its too small: IT'S A MICRO ATA CASE - !MICRO!. I will say one thing - remember to add 2 inches to the length for the power cord. I forgot this and it made the fit tough in the TV stand (but not the fault of the case). Remember, its a MICRO case. Things will be tight. I am sure not all compents will fit (all of mine did though). If this is a concern, then do not get a Micro, or do research before buying.
